TXNM Dividend FAQ

Does TXNM pay a dividend?

Yes, as of June 2025, TXNM paid a dividend of 1.59 USD in the last 12 months. The last dividend was paid on 2025-04-25 and the payout was 0.408 USD.

What is the Dividend Yield of TXNM?

As of June 2025, TXNM`s dividend yield is 3.06%. This is calculated by dividing the trailing 12-month dividend rate (TTM rate) of 1.59 USD by the current share price of 56.43.

How often does TXNM pay dividends?

TXNM pays dividends quarterly. Over the last 12 months (TTM), TXNM has issued 4 dividend payments.

What is the Dividend Growth of TXNM?

TXNM's average dividend growth rate over the past 5 years is 4.73% per year.
Strong growth: TXNM's Dividend growth is outpacing inflation.

What is the Yield on Cost of TXNM?

TXNM's 5-Year Yield on Cost is 4.88%. If you bought TXNM's shares at 32.63 USD five years ago, your current annual dividend income (1.59 USD per share, trailing 12 months) equals 4.88% of your original purchase price.

What is the Payout Consistency of TXNM?

TXNM Payout Consistency is 62.5%. The payout consistency is a proprietary measure of how consistently a company has paid dividends over its lifetime and blends growth rate, number of dividend payments, interruptions or lowering dividends into one number.

Key Metric Definitions

  • Dividend Yield: Annual dividend per share divided by current share price.
  • Dividend Growth Rate: Compound annual growth rate of annual dividend per share over the last 5 years.
  • Payout Ratio: Percentage of earnings paid as dividends (TTM).
  • Payout Consistency: % of eligible periods with uninterrupted or increased dividends, measured over the entire lifetime of the stock or fund.
  • Payout Frequency: Number of dividends paid per year (typically quarterly).
  • Overall Dividend Rating: Proprietary composite score, quantified on a scale from 0 to +100. Ratings surpassing 70 are regarded as favorable, while those exceeding 85 are strong.
  • Total Return: Price appreciation plus dividends over specified period.
  • Market Cap: Figures are in millions of the corresponding currency.
